Spring House, PA Profile
Spring House, PA, population 3,290 , is located
in Pennsylvania's Montgomery county,
about 16.5 miles from Philadelphia and 32.4 miles from Allentown.
In the 90's the population of Spring House has grown by about 18%.

Drug detox is the first step in the Spring House, PA. rehabilitation treatment process toward recovery from a drug and alcohol addiction. The main goal in this component of the Spring House Alcohol Rehabilitation or Drug Rehab Facility is to rid the body of toxins that accumulate over the course of a long term drug or alcohol addiction. It is very common to see individuals from Spring House, PA. in drug detox that has combined different drugs such as marijuana, cocaine, heroin, or pain pills with alcohol.
When an individual from Spring House has sustained the use of any of these various kinds of drugs, it causes adaptations within their body that lessen the drug's original effects over time; this is a phenomenon that is known as drug tolerance. At this point, the individual from Spring House, Pennsylvania has developed a physical dependency on the substance and withdrawal symptoms will be experienced upon discontinuation. The reason that it is imperative that an individual from Spring House have professional supervision during the detox process is because the staff at an Alcohol Treatment or Drug Rehabilitation Center can help to make this process much easier by administering elements of treatment that can help to alleviate some of the painful withdrawal symptoms.
Once the early stages of withdrawal have passed, an individual from Spring House will then be able to begin a directed, Drug Rehab or Alcohol Rehabilitation Program that will begin to address aspects of the psychological dependency by teaching behavioral skills that will help them to function without the use of alcohol or drugs. This component in drug recovery treatment will usually involve some type of individual or group counseling. There may also be occupational and behavioral therapies that are utilized as components of treatment in order to help to teach the individual from Spring House, PA. life and social skills that may have been lost while they were under the influence of addiction.

Did You Know? ... Interesting Facts and Statistics:
Persons who made no effort to receive treatment were more likely to report that they were not ready to stop using (45.3 percent) as a reason for not receiving treatment than persons who made an effort to receive treatment (21.1 percent) (2004-2005 combined data). Among those who made no effort to receive treatment, 26.3 percent reported stigma and 31.0 percent reported cost and insurance barriers as reasons for not receiving treatment.
Nationally, 6.2 percent of all persons aged 12 or older reported using marijuana in the past month in 2002.2003 (Table B.3). Because marijuana is the predominant substance used by those using an illegal drug, States that had high prevalence rates for any illegal drug also had high prevalence rates for past month use of marijuana. Eight out of ten States in the top fifth for use of an illegal drug for persons aged 12 or older also were ranked in the top fifth for past month use of marijuana. In the 12 to 17 age group, seven States were in the top fifth for both use of any illegal drug and use of marijuana: Colorado, Hawaii, Massachusetts, Montana, New Hampshire, New Mexico, and Vermont. Eight States were common to the top fifth for past month marijuana use among persons aged 12 or older and teens aged 12 to 17: Alaska, Colorado, Maine, Massachusetts, Montana, New Hampshire, Rhode Island, and Vermont. The States with the lowest rates of past month use of marijuana among persons aged 12 or older were in the South: Alabama, Georgia, Mississippi, Tennessee, and Texas. The other States in the lowest fifth were Idaho, Iowa, Kansas, New Jersey, and Utah .
